Comments and Suggestions for AuthorsThe article presents a well-structured and methodologically rigorous study that contributes valuable insights into the representation of university dual training in the Spanish higher education context. Its systematic approach and clear integration of content and discourse analysis make it a significant addition to current educational communication research. However, the article has some weak issues. These are lack of international context, apllied value and limitations. To be more specific, here are the following recommendations, which, I hope, will improve this article.
Recommendations:
-
Expand the comparative perspective by including international examples or analysis of social media sources.
-
Add quantitative indicators of intercoder reliability to strengthen methodological transparency.
-
Develop a section with specific practical recommendations for universities.
-
Create a separate subsection titled “Limitations and Future Research” at the end of Disscussion and Conclusions section.
-
Proofread the entire article carefully — on page 13, line 410, one reference remains in Cyrillic and has not been translated into English.
-
Correct minor linguistic inconsistencies throughout the text.
-
Improve the readability and resolution of Figures 4 and 5, which are currently unclear.

Comments and Suggestions for AuthorsThe methodology is sound, the approach robust and the data presented easily accessible. However the subject material is far more data science focused and less journalistic. The submission as a whole and the research question draw on news media but it may suit a more technologically focused publication, unless editors feel it aligns with the journal scopes. The findings drawing on Spanish media do offer good case study examples for scholars of European media and the journal article is well written. Overall this is a solid piece of work but it may suit an education or HE journal more than a media one.

Regarding your observation suggesting that the article may be more suited to an education-oriented journal, we would like to clarify that although the phenomenon studied is situated within the university context, the core focus of the research lies firmly within the field of communication and media studies, which is fully aligned with the aims and scope of Journalism and Media.
Specifically, this manuscript:
- Examines the role of digital university media as public communication actors responsible for producing and managing news content within the digital journalism ecosystem.
• Explores how these media outlets contribute to shaping the agenda and public understanding of an emerging educational policy, acknowledging the contemporary transformations taking place in media communication.
• Focuses on news production and consumption, communication management, the social and political impact of media discourse, and the institutional role of journalism in the construction of public knowledge—topics clearly included within the journal’s scope.
• Provides original empirical evidence on the intersections between communication, technology, higher education, and socioeconomic development, contributing meaningfully to current debates on media in globalized societies.
In line with this, the article incorporates a methodological and theoretical approach grounded in media studies and offers a critical interpretation of the role of institutional communication in mediating between universities, companies, citizens, and public policies. For these reasons, we believe the manuscript offers new and relevant insights for the field of journalism and media, fully meeting the mission of Journalism and Media to advance the understanding of the social and political dimensions of communication.
